#2c43e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c43e0 is composed of 17.3% red, 26.3%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.4% cyan, 70.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 232.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 52.5%. #2c43e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#5886ff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2c43e0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030b is the darkest color, while #f9f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c43e0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80818c is the less saturated color, while #102efc is the most saturated one.
